Production equipment for continuously producing and sintering archaized building materials and red bricks
By installing a sealing cover on the kiln car and using non-combustible materials as sealing filler, combined with hoisting components, continuous covering of brick blanks is achieved, solving the problems of high cost and discontinuity in antique building material production equipment, and realizing low-cost continuous production and flexible switching.

Technical Field
[0001] This utility model relates to the field of kiln technology, and in particular to a production equipment for continuous production of sintered antique building materials and red bricks. Background Technology
[0002] Currently, antique-style building materials are mainly produced in small, scattered kilns across the country. These kilns have low production capacity, long production cycles, high energy waste, serious pollution, and cannot be produced continuously. The average cost for standard bricks is between 0.8 and 1.2 yuan. There are also shuttle kilns that use natural gas, with a cost between 0.6 and 1 yuan. These kilns also cannot be produced continuously due to their intermittent production, resulting in significant heat loss and high heat consumption from both heat storage and dissipation. Additionally, there are roller kilns, which are suitable for tile production due to the material of the rollers. The cost for producing blue bricks is also between 0.8 and 1 yuan.
[0003] Developing a production equipment for the continuous production of sintered antique-style building materials and red bricks, without the need for adding water, gas, or combustible powder for oxygen isolation, and without the need for gas exchange, thus simplifying the manufacturing process and reducing costs, has become a technical problem that urgently needs to be solved by those skilled in the art. [0023] like Figure 1-5 As shown, a production equipment for continuous production of sintered antique building materials and red bricks includes a kiln car 1, on the upper surface of the kiln car 1, a cover 2 covering the outer periphery of the brick blank, and the lower opening of the cover 2 abutting against the upper surface of the kiln car 1.
[0024] The upper surface of the cover 2 is fixedly equipped with a lifting lug 3;
[0025] A hoisting assembly is installed across the upper surface of the kiln car 1 along the kiln exit path, and the hoisting assembly is connected to the lifting lug 3.
[0026] Specifically, a sealing filler is placed between the upper surface of the kiln car 1 and the contact surface of the opening of the cover 2. The powder can fill the gap between the contact surface of the cover and the kiln car to ensure the sealing effect.
[0027] Specifically, the sealing filler is made of non-combustible materials such as sand or soil.
[0028] Specifically, the lower opening of the cover 2 is provided with a receiving groove 4, and fireproof cotton or asbestos is placed inside the receiving groove 4. The cover can maintain a sealing device with the upper surface of the kiln car through the flexible materials such as fireproof cotton or asbestos inside the receiving groove.
[0029] Specifically, the hoisting assembly includes a frame 5, on which a hoisting trolley 7 is movably mounted. The hoisting trolley 7 is connected to the lifting lugs 3 via slings 6, enabling the covering and removal of covers on the brick blanks, ensuring the continuity of the brick blank firing process.
[0030] The process of making, drying and firing antique-style building materials is the same as that of red bricks. They are fired to about 950°C. Starting from the annealing section, an opening is made on the corresponding kiln surface, and a sliding top cover is made to facilitate the lifting trolley to close the cover. The cover is closed at 600°C to 800°C. After being taken out of the kiln, it is placed to cool naturally to obtain antique-style building materials.
[0031] This allows brick blanks from the same kiln car to be converted into antique-style building materials and red bricks by covering them after they leave the kiln.
[0032] Example 1
[0033] The bottom of the cover is sealed with fine powder. When the cover is placed above 600°C and the kiln is opened after 12 hours, the cover temperature is around 230°C. At this time, the powder under the cover is blown open, and bubbles rise from the powder. The air pressure inside the cover is kept positive, so there is no need to add other oxygen-barrier substances, such as water, water vapor, carbon dioxide, or gases after air combustion. In addition, when the brick blank is covered, there is still a small amount of unburned carbon. After the cover is placed, the air inside the cover will help consume the oxygen. By sealing the contact surface between the cover and the kiln car, the annealing section temperature is above 600°C when the cover is placed, resulting in a stable yield of over 99%.
